This oceanside park offers stunning views, the chance to get up close to Maine’s oldest lighthouse, and paved paths for strolling near the shore.

Photo by: Kim Foley MacKinnon
Fort Williams Park, home to the oldest lighthouse in Maine, is about as picture-postcard perfect as it gets. Don’t forget to bring your camera! Ocean views, historic properties, and plenty of paved paths, swings, picnic tables, and cooking grills make for a perfect outing for families.
Fort Williams was once a military asset during World War II, protecting the shoreline of Cape Elizabeth. It was officially closed and deactivated in 1963. Portland Head Light, the centerpiece of the park, has a museum and gift shop.
The park has views of Ram Island Ledge Light and the islands of Casco Bay as well as playing fields and tennis courts. The paved paths are great for bicylcles. In winter, the park offers great places to cross-country ski or sled.
Remember: The museum—which has a number of lighthouse lenses and interpretive displays—is open seasonally with limited hours. Call or visit its website for details.
Plan B:Head into Portland and wander around the historic Old Port section of town.
Where to Eat Nearby:Cottage Road offers a variety of ice cream shops and pizza places.
